Egocentrism
The cognitive inability to understand or assume any perspective other than one's own, commonly observed in children during the preoperational stage of development.
Infantile Amnesia
The common inability of adults to remember the earliest years of their childhood, typically from birth until around 4 years of age.
Stranger Anxiety
Describes a developmental stage in infants and young children where they experience fear or distress around unfamiliar people.
Assimilation
The cognitive process of integrating new information into existing schemas or frameworks, often discussed in the context of learning and development.
